
Celebrate Mother’s Day with Free Admission for Moms at Milwaukee County Zoo
This Mother's Day, the Milwaukee County Zoo is inviting all mothers to celebrate the occasion with free admission from 9:30 a.m. to 4:30 p.m. on Sunday, May 11. It's a special opportunity for human moms to enjoy the day surrounded by animal mothers and their adorable offspring, highlighting the importance of maternal bonds in both the animal kingdom and human life.

One of the heartwarming highlights this year is Bactrian camel, Addie-Jean, affectionately known as A.J., who recently welcomed a baby boy on April 20. Visitors can observe this lovely pair enjoying their time together in the Camel Yard, a perfect illustration of the nurturing role of mothers in the animal world.

At the Small Mammals building, guests will find prehensile-tailed porcupine Quinn, who has recently given birth to her sixth porcupette. The bonding experience is incredibly rich, with Quinn and her newborn enjoying exclusive time together, while their father, Seamus, has been temporarily relocated to foster this nurturing environment.
In addition to celebrating local animal moms, the Milwaukee County Zoo is also supporting the Missing Orangutan Mothers (MOM) campaign. This initiative serves to raise awareness about the critical bonds between orangutan mothers and their young, who typically stay with their mothers for about eight years. As part of the festivities, visitors can purchase orangutan-themed cookies and art-decorated necklaces, with proceeds dedicated to conservation and rehabilitation efforts in Indonesia.
While admission is free thanks to the generosity of Peoples State Bank, guests are reminded that parking and regular attraction fees will still apply. Peoples State Bank will also host giveaways at their event booth inside the zoo—an extra incentive to celebrate this special occasion.
